The Shriner Peak Trail room has deep vintage hues of gold and silhouette and exquisitely detailed wall paper. A double window looks out over the library grounds and local businesses. The queen bed is deep and inviting with 4 pillows. The reach-in closet has a shelf and a place to hang your clothes. The antique vanity has two drawers and feature an extra shelf with the mirror. We've kept the original wood floor but put down an area rug to keep your feet warm.  We keep fresh towels in the top of the closet for the bathroom just a few steps down the hall. If you visit in the autumn, gazing south and east out of your window beyond the weeping willow manicured by grazing elk, the glow of a rising moon shines over the town. This is one of nine unique rooms and suites, each decorated with combinations of William Morris wallpapers and light and dark hues. All are named for local hiking trails. The hotel has two main floors and an old-west covered wrap-around deck ideal for lounging and gathering. Eight of the guest rooms and suites are on the hotel's second floor, with the ninth in the adjacent ground level cabin. Each room accommodates one or two guests, age 18 and over. All second floor rooms and suites are accessed by stairs. Five hotel suites have private bathrooms with tiled showers. Four have access to two shared bathrooms and showers a few steps down the second floor hall. Each guest bathroom in the main hotel boasts classic black and white hex tile floors and subway tile showers. Amenities include free wifi, thoughtfully sourced plush towels, luxury bedding, two types of pillows, luggage racks, hair dryers, Comphy embroidered robes, and Public Goods bath products. Full length room-darkening curtains insulate for sound and temperature and encourage deep restful sleep. Additional toiletry items are available upon request (toothbrush, toothpaste, floss, insect repellant, q-tips, emery boards, personal feminine items). A phone is located in the lobby if guests need to make a call. Locally roasted coffee is served every morning, with breakfast service coming soon!
